What companies run services between Firenze Santa Maria Novella, Italy and Porto Santo Stefano, Italy?

Autolinee Toscane operates a bus from Stazione Leopolda to Grosseto F.S. 5 times a day. Tickets cost €9–12 and the journey takes 2h 6m. Alternatively, Trenitalia operates a train from Firenze S.M.N. to Orbetello-Monte Arg. twice daily. Tickets cost €30–55 and the journey takes 3h 8m.
